Tiree Sports Day

Saturday 27th July 2012
TBC

Races for all ages, including field and track events and the ever popular heavy events. The highlight of the day is the resident versus non-resident men’s tug o war and yes we have one for the ladies too, finally the winning ladies take on the winning men. The Tiree Ladies have cleared the floor for the last few years! All events are free to enter.
